Understanding Your Needs

The first step in finding a therapist is to understand your personal needs. Are you dealing with anxiety, depression, or relationship issues? Knowing your primary concerns will help narrow down your search.

Types of Therapists

  • Psychologists: Specialize in diagnosing and treating mental health disorders.
  • Counselors: Focus on talk therapy for various life challenges.
  • Psychiatrists: Medical doctors who can prescribe medication.

Checking Credentials

Ensure that the therapist you are considering is licensed and holds the necessary qualifications. You can check this through state licensing boards or professional associations.

Questions to Ask Potential Therapists

Before making a decision, it's important to interview potential therapists. Here are some questions to consider:

  1. What is your approach to therapy?
  2. Have you treated clients with similar issues?
  3. What are your fees and do you accept insurance?

These questions can help you determine if a therapist is the right fit for your needs.

Therapy Formats

Therapy can take many forms, including individual sessions, group therapy, and online counseling. Each format has its own advantages.

Individual Therapy

This is a one-on-one session with a therapist, providing personalized attention and confidentiality.

Group Therapy

Group sessions can offer support and perspectives from others who share similar experiences.

Making the Most of Therapy

To get the most out of therapy, it's essential to be open and honest with your therapist. Regular attendance and active participation are key to progress.

FAQ

  • How do I find a good therapist in Austin?

    Start by identifying your specific needs, then use online directories, local referrals, and consult state licensing boards to ensure the therapist's credentials.

  • What should I expect during my first therapy session?

    The first session typically involves discussing your history and what brings you to therapy. It's an opportunity to ask questions and set goals with your therapist.
